Transaction 57a593084c03c33c8c759004d81327880c0398563515dff1d66046bce0f94b9e
1 Input
1 Output
-
57a593084c03c33c8c759004d81327880c0398563515dff1d66046bce0f94b9e:0
- value
- 164442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0e621d3c87c228b0a693e81a50b541f3e7fb772 OP_EQUAL
- address
- 3NCAyNhqFbmNThJPX3Uny4Juys1b3d2yAW